Dijital Estetiğin Mimarları: Tema Çakışmalarını Çözen Uzmanların 2026 VizyonuKapsamlı İnceleme
Modern web ekosistemi, her geçen gün daha karmaşık hale gelen katmanlı bir yapıdan oluşmaktadır. Bir web sitesinin görsel arayüzü, sadece renkler ve fontlardan ibaret değildir; arka planda çalışan binlerce satırlık CSS, JavaScript ve PHP kodunun kusursuz bir senfoni içinde hareket etmesi gerekir. Ancak, farklı geliştiriciler tarafından hazırlanan temaların, eklentilerin ve özel scriptlerin bir araya gelmesi, çoğu zaman “tema çakışması” (theme conflict) adı verilen teknik krizlere yol açar. Bu krizler, butonların kaymasından menülerin çalışmamasına, hatta sitenin tamamen erişilemez hale gelmesine kadar uzanan geniş bir sorun yelpazesi sunar. İşte bu noktada, tema çakışması sorunlarını giderip sitenin görünümünü düzelten uzmanlar, dijital dünyanın “restorasyon sanatçıları” olarak devreye girmektedir. 2026 yılına doğru ilerlerken, bu uzmanlık alanı sadece hata ayıklama (debugging) değil, aynı zamanda yapay zeka entegrasyonu ve performans optimizasyonu ile birleşerek stratejik bir disipline dönüşmektedir.
- Kod Hiyerarşisinin Optimizasyonu: Çakışmaların temel nedeni olan CSS öncelik sıralamasının (specificity) modern standartlara göre yeniden düzenlenmesi.
- Kullanıcı Deneyimi (UX) Restorasyonu: Görsel bozulmaların giderilerek dönüşüm oranlarının ve kullanıcıda güven duygusunun artırılması.
- Performans ve Hız Kazanımı: Gereksiz kod yüklerinin temizlenmesiyle Core Web Vitals değerlerinin iyileştirilmesi.
- Geleceğe Hazırlık: 2026 trendleri olan mikro-etkileşimler ve konteyner sorguları (container queries) ile uyumlu bir altyapı oluşturulması.
- Güvenlik ve Stabilite: Çakışan scriptlerin yarattığı güvenlik açıklarının kapatılarak sitenin sürdürülebilir kılınması.
| Sorun Türü | Geleneksel Yaklaşım | Uzman Müdahalesi (2026 Vizyonu) | Beklenen Sonuç |
|---|---|---|---|
| CSS Çakışmaları | “!important” etiketi kullanımı | CSS Değişkenleri ve Katmanlı (Layer) Mimari | Temiz ve yönetilebilir stil dosyaları |
| JavaScript Hataları | Eklenti devre dışı bırakma | Asenkron Yükleme ve Kod İzolasyonu | Kesintisiz çalışan dinamik özellikler |
| Mobil Görünüm Bozukluğu | Genel medya sorguları | Yapay Zeka Destekli Adaptif Tasarım | Tüm cihazlarda kusursuz görüntü |
| Yavaş Yükleme Süreleri | Önbellek eklentileri | Kod Ağaç Yapısı Temizliği (Tree Shaking) | Milisaniyelik açılış hızları |
Tema Çakışması Nedir ve Neden Kritik Bir Sorundur?
Tema çakışması, bir web sitesindeki iki veya daha fazla kod bileşeninin aynı kaynağı kontrol etmeye çalışması veya birinin diğerinin çalışmasını engellemesi durumudur. Genellikle bir WordPress teması ile yüklü olan bir eklentinin aynı CSS sınıflarını kullanması veya JavaScript kütüphanelerinin (örneğin jQuery’nin farklı sürümleri) birbiriyle yarışması sonucunda ortaya çıkar. Bu durum, kullanıcı için sadece görsel bir rahatsızlık değil, aynı zamanda markanın profesyonelliğine vurulan büyük bir darbedir. 2026 yılında kullanıcıların bir web sitesinden beklentisi “anlık” ve “kusursuz” olmasıdır; milimetrik bir kayma bile kullanıcının siteyi terk etmesine neden olabilir.
Bir uzman gözüyle bakıldığında, çakışmalar sadece yüzeydeki bozulmalar değildir. Arka planda tarayıcının (browser) render motorunu yoran, işlemci gücünü gereksiz tüketen ve sitenin SEO puanını aşağı çeken birer teknik borçtur (technical debt). Örneğin, bir butonun rengini değiştirmek için yazılan hatalı bir CSS kodu, sitenin tüm mizanpajını etkileyen bir domino etkisine yol açabilir. Bu tür sorunlar, sitenin arama motoru sonuç sayfalarındaki (SERP) konumunu doğrudan etkileyen “Cumulative Layout Shift” (Kümülatif Düzen Kayması) skorlarını da olumsuz yönde tetikler.
Bu sorunun kritikliği, günümüzde dijital varlıkların birer satış ofisi gibi çalışmasından kaynaklanmaktadır. Bir e-ticaret sitesinde ödeme butonunun tema çakışması nedeniyle görünmemesi veya tıklanamaz olması, doğrudan maddi kayıp demektir. Uzmanlar, bu karmaşayı çözmek için sadece kodu düzeltmekle kalmaz, aynı zamanda sitenin kod mimarisini “geleceğe yönelik” (future-proof) hale getirerek benzer sorunların tekrar yaşanmamasını sağlarlar. Bu süreç, kodun atomik düzeyde incelenmesini ve her bir fonksiyonun kendi izole alanında çalışmasının garanti altına alınmasını içerir.
2026 Web Tasarım Trendlerinde Kod Uyumluluğunun Rolü
2026 yılına yaklaştığımızda, web tasarım dünyasında “Hyper-Personalization” (Aşırı Kişiselleştirme) ve “Generative UI” (Üretken Kullanıcı Arayüzü) kavramlarının öne çıktığını görüyoruz. Bu yeni nesil tasarım anlayışı, her kullanıcıya özel bir arayüz sunmayı hedeflerken, kod tabanının esnek ve çakışmalardan arınmış olmasını zorunlu kılar. Tema çakışması sorunlarını gideren uzmanlar, artık sadece statik sayfaları tamir etmiyor; yapay zeka tarafından dinamik olarak oluşturulan arayüzlerin, sitenin ana iskeletiyle uyumlu çalışmasını sağlıyorlar.
Geleceğin web siteleri, “Container Queries” ve “CSS Layers” gibi modern teknolojileri standart olarak kullanacak. Bu teknolojiler, bir bileşenin (component) sadece kendi içinde bir dünya gibi davranmasına olanak tanır. Ancak bu ileri seviye tekniklerin uygulanması, derin bir uzmanlık gerektirir. Uzmanlar, sitenizin görünümünü düzeltirken bu yeni nesil standartları entegre ederek, sitenizin 2026’nın cihazlarına ve tarayıcılarına tam uyumlu olmasını sağlarlar. Bu, sadece bir tamir işlemi değil, sitenin dijital çağa adaptasyon sürecidir.
Ayrıca, sürdürülebilirlik ve “Yeşil Kod” (Green Coding) akımı da 2026 trendleri arasında kritik bir yer tutmaktadır. Gereksiz kod çakışmalarının temizlenmesi, sunucu tarafındaki yükü azaltarak enerji tasarrufu sağlar. Uzman bir müdahale ile optimize edilen bir web sitesi, daha az veri transferi yaparak hem kullanıcı dostu olur hem de çevreye duyarlı bir dijital iz bırakır. Bu vizyonla hareket eden bir uzman, sitenizi sadece görsel olarak değil, etik ve teknik olarak da üst seviyeye taşır.
CSS ve JavaScript Çatışmalarını Teşhis Etme Yöntemleri
Bir uzman, tema çakışmalarını teşhis ederken adeta bir dedektif gibi iz sürer. İlk adım, tarayıcı geliştirici araçlarını (DevTools) kullanarak konsol hatalarını ve stil hiyerarşisini analiz etmektir. JavaScript hataları genellikle kırmızı uyarılarla kendini belli ederken, CSS çakışmaları “Computed Styles” sekmesinde hangi kuralın diğerini ezdiğini görmekle çözülür. Uzmanlar, bu aşamada “Regression Testing” (Gerileme Testi) yaparak, yapılan bir düzeltmenin sitenin başka bir yerini bozup bozmadığını kontrol ederler.
Teşhis sürecinde kullanılan bir diğer ileri teknik ise “Code Splitting” ve “Isolating Components” yöntemleridir. Eğer bir eklenti sitenin genel görünümünü bozuyorsa, uzman bu eklentinin kodlarını bir “Shadow DOM” içine hapsederek, ana tema ile etkileşimini sınırlar. Bu sayede, eklentinin sunduğu özellik korunurken, görsel bütünlüğün bozulması engellenir. Bu tür bir müdahale, standart bir kullanıcının veya basit bir destek ekibinin yapabileceği seviyenin çok üzerindedir ve derin mimari bilgi gerektirir.
💡 Analiz: 2025 verilerine göre bu konu, dijital stratejilerde kritik bir rol oynamaktadır. Gelecek vizyonu için teknik altyapı önemlidir.
Modern teşhis araçları artık yapay zeka destekli analizler de sunmaktadır. Uzmanlar, sitenin kod yapısını tarayan ve potansiyel çakışma noktalarını önceden tahmin eden AI tabanlı scriptler kullanırlar. Bu proaktif yaklaşım, sorun henüz kullanıcılar tarafından fark edilmeden tespit edilip çözülmesini sağlar. Görünüm bozuklukları teşhis edilirken, farklı ekran çözünürlükleri, tarayıcı motorları (Blink, WebKit, Gecko) ve işletim sistemleri arasındaki farklar da tek tek simüle edilerek %100 uyumluluk hedeflenir.
Modern Framework’lerde (React, Vue, Tailwind) Çakışma Yönetimi
Günümüzde birçok web sitesi artık sadece basit temalarla değil, React, Vue.js gibi kütüphaneler veya Tailwind CSS gibi frameworkler üzerine inşa edilmektedir. Bu modern yapılar, doğası gereği daha modüler olsa da, geleneksel CMS (içerik yönetim sistemleri) yapılarıyla birleştirildiklerinde karmaşık çakışmalar yaratabilirler. Bir uzman, bu modern stack’lerde çakışma yönetimi yaparken “Scoped CSS” ve “CSS Modules” gibi yöntemleri kullanarak her bileşenin stilini kendi içine hapseder.
Özellikle Tailwind CSS gibi “utility-first” yaklaşımlarda, sınıf isimlerinin (class names) birbiriyle çakışma ihtimali düşüktür; ancak projenin büyüklüğüne göre “Purge” ayarlarının yanlış yapılması veya yapılandırma dosyalarındaki hatalar, sitenin bir anda stilini kaybetmesine yol açabilir. Uzman, bu framework’lerin konfigürasyon dosyalarını optimize ederek, sadece gerekli olan CSS’in yüklenmesini sağlar. Bu, hem çakışmaları önler hem de sitenin performansını maksimize eder.
JavaScript tarafında ise, farklı kütüphanelerin global değişkenleri kirletmesi (global namespace pollution) en büyük sorundur. Uzman bir geliştirici, bu durumu engellemek için “Webpack” veya “Vite” gibi araçlarla kod paketlemesi (bundling) yapar. Her bir script kendi kapsülünde (encapsulation) çalıştırılarak, birbirlerinin fonksiyonlarını geçersiz kılmaları engellenir. Bu modern yaklaşım, sitenin hem daha hızlı hem de daha güvenli bir altyapıya sahip olmasını garanti eder.
Kullanıcı Deneyimi (UX) ve Sayfa Hızı Üzerindeki Görsel Etkiler
Tema çakışmalarının en somut faturası, kullanıcı deneyimi ve sayfa hızı üzerinden kesilir. Bir butonun yanlış yerde durması veya yazıların birbirinin üzerine binmesi, kullanıcıda “bu site güvenilir değil” algısı yaratır. Psikolojik araştırmalar, kullanıcıların bir web sitesinin kalitesini saniyeler içinde görsel uyuma göre değerlendirdiğini göstermektedir. Uzmanlar, bu görsel pürüzleri gidererek kullanıcı yolculuğunu (user journey) pürüzsüz hale getirirler.
Sayfa hızı açısından bakıldığında, çakışan kodlar tarayıcının sayfayı render etme süresini uzatır. Tarayıcı, bir elementi hangi kurala göre çizeceğine karar vermeye çalışırken saniyeler kaybedebilir. “Render-blocking resources” (işlemeyi engelleyen kaynaklar) olarak adlandırılan bu durum, Google’ın Core Web Vitals metriklerini doğrudan etkiler. Uzman bir müdahale ile gereksiz stil tekrarları ve çakışan scriptler temizlendiğinde, sitenin LCP (En Büyük İçerikli Boyama) süresi dramatik şekilde düşer.
Görsel stabilite, 2026’da SEO’nun en kritik bileşenlerinden biri olmaya devam edecektir. CLS (Cumulative Layout Shift) sorunları, özellikle sayfa yüklenirken öğelerin yer değiştirmesiyle kullanıcıların yanlış yere tıklamasına neden olur. Tema çakışması uzmanları, elementlerin boyutlarını ve yerleşimlerini kod seviyesinde sabitleyerek bu kaymaları sıfıra indirir. Sonuç; daha mutlu kullanıcılar, daha yüksek dönüşüm oranları ve Google gözünde daha değerli bir web sitesidir.
Yapay Zeka Destekli Hata Ayıklama Araçlarının Geleceği
2026 vizyonunda, tema çakışmalarını çözmek artık manuel kod satırları arasında kaybolmaktan çıkıp, yapay zeka ile iş birliği yapmaya dönüşüyor. Uzmanlar, kendi geliştirdikleri veya mevcut gelişmiş AI modellerini kullanarak sitenin kod yapısındaki anomalileri anlık olarak tespit edebiliyorlar. “Self-healing code” (kendi kendini iyileştiren kod) kavramı, bu uzmanlığın bir parçası haline gelmeye başlamıştır.
Yapay zeka, milyonlarca satır kodu tarayarak hangi CSS kuralının hangi cihazda sorun çıkaracağını saniyeler içinde öngörebilir. Ancak, AI’nın sunduğu bu verileri yorumlamak ve sitenin marka kimliğine uygun şekilde optimize etmek hala insan uzmanlığının tekelindedir. Uzmanlar, AI araçlarını birer asistan olarak kullanarak, karmaşık mantıksal hataları ve nadir görülen tarayıcı uyumsuzluklarını çözmede inanılmaz bir hız kazanmaktadırlar.
Gelecekte, web sitelerinin yönetim panellerine entegre edilen AI botları, bir eklenti yüklendiğinde oluşabilecek potansiyel çakışmaları uzmanlara raporlayacak. Bu “önleyici bakım” (preventative maintenance) yaklaşımı, sitenin görünümünün bozulmasını daha başlamadan engelleyecektir. Uzmanlar, bu sistemlerin kurulumunu ve denetimini yaparak, işletmelerin teknik sorunlarla vakit kaybetmesini önleyecek stratejik birer teknoloji danışmanı rolünü üstleneceklerdir.
🚀 İpucu: Başarıya ulaşmak için sürekli optimizasyon ve güncel takip şarttır. Bu rehberdeki adımları uygulayın.
Bir Uzmanla Çalışmanın İşletme Verimliliğine Katkısı
Birçok işletme sahibi, tema çakışmalarını “kendin yap” (DIY) yöntemleriyle veya ucuz eklentilerle çözmeye çalışırken daha büyük sorunlara yol açar. Profesyonel bir uzmanla çalışmak, kısa vadede bir maliyet gibi görünse de uzun vadede büyük bir tasarruf sağlar. Uzman, sorunun köküne inerek kalıcı çözümler üretir; böylece her güncellemede sitenin tekrar bozulması riskini ortadan kaldırır.
İşletme verimliliği açısından bakıldığında, teknik sorunlarla boğuşmayan bir ekip, kendi işine ve pazarlama stratejilerine odaklanabilir. Sitenin görünümünün düzgün olması, reklam kampanyalarından gelen trafiğin daha yüksek oranda satışa dönüşmesini (conversion rate optimization) sağlar. Tema çakışması uzmanı, aslında dolaylı olarak pazarlama ekibinin de başarısına katkıda bulunur.
Ayrıca, teknik destek maliyetlerinin düşmesi de önemli bir avantajdır. İyi yapılandırılmış, çakışmalardan arındırılmış bir web sitesi, daha az bakım gerektirir. Uzmanlar, sitenin altyapısını temizleyerek “teknik borcu” minimize ederler. Bu da gelecekte yapılacak yeni özellik eklemelerinin daha kolay, daha hızlı ve daha ucuz olmasını sağlar. Dijital dünyada hız ve esneklik kazanmak, rekabet avantajı elde etmenin anahtarıdır.
Sıkça Sorulan Sorular (SSS)
1. Tema çakışması olduğunu nasıl anlarım?
Sitenizde butonların çalışmaması, menülerin açılmaması, fontların aniden değişmesi veya sayfa düzeninin (layout) kayması gibi belirtiler genellikle bir tema veya eklenti çakışmasına işaret eder. Tarayıcıda sağ tıklayıp “İncele” diyerek “Console” sekmesine baktığınızda kırmızı hatalar görüyorsanız, teknik bir çakışma yaşıyorsunuz demektir.
2. Yeni bir eklenti yüklemek sitemin görünümünü bozar mı?
Evet, özellikle zayıf kodlanmış eklentiler kendi CSS ve JavaScript dosyalarını yüklerken sitenizin mevcut kurallarını ezebilir. Bu durum, özellikle sayfa yapıcılar (Elementor, WPBakery vb.) ile birlikte kullanılan ek eklentilerde sıkça görülür.
3. Bu sorunları bir eklenti kullanarak çözebilir miyim?
Bazı “Asset Management” eklentileri (örneğin Asset CleanUp veya Perfmatters) belirli scriptleri devre dışı bırakmanıza yardımcı olabilir. Ancak, köklü bir çakışma varsa bu eklentiler yetersiz kalabilir ve yanlış bir ayar sitenizi tamamen bozabilir. Kalıcı çözüm için uzman müdahalesi şarttır.
4. Tema çakışması SEO puanımı düşürür mü?
Kesinlikle. Google’ın Core Web Vitals ölçümleri, sayfa hızı ve görsel stabiliteye büyük önem verir. Çakışmalar nedeniyle oluşan düzen kaymaları (CLS) ve yavaş yükleme süreleri, arama motoru sıralamanızı doğrudan olumsuz etkiler.
5. Profesyonel bir uzman bu sorunları ne kadar sürede çözer?
Sorunun karmaşıklığına bağlı olarak, basit çakışmalar birkaç saat içinde çözülebilirken, derin mimari hatalar ve framework uyumsuzlukları birkaç günlük bir çalışma gerektirebilir. Uzman, önce bir analiz yaparak size net bir zaman çizelgesi sunacaktır.
Sonuç olarak, web sitenizin görünümü ve performansı, dijital dünyadaki itibarınızın temelidir. Tema çakışmaları bu itibarı zedeleyen gizli düşmanlardır. 2026 vizyonuyla hareket eden, modern teknolojilere hakim ve kullanıcı deneyimini önceliğine alan bir uzmanla çalışmak, sitenizi sadece tamir etmekle kalmaz, onu geleceğin dijital standartlarına taşır. Kodların uyumu, başarınızın anahtarıdır.
💡 Özetle
Tema çakışması sorunlarını gideren uzmanlar, karmaşık kod yapılarını optimize ederek web sitelerinin görsel bütünlüğünü ve performansını 2026 standartlarına uygun şekilde restore ederler. Bu profesyonel müdahale, kullanıcı deneyimini iyileştirirken SEO başarısını ve işletme verimliliğini kalıcı olarak artırır.
AI-Powered Analysis by MeoMan Bot


